Tutoriel macro excel erreur?

jan_clode Messages postés 2 Statut Membre -  
jan_clode Messages postés 2 Statut Membre -
Bonjour
J'ai trouve un tutoriel tres bien fait sur les macros excel:
http://www.info-3000.com/vbvba/

Mais il semblerait qu'il y aie un probleme dans la section tableaux.
J'ai teste une macro de tableaux et il y a une erreur qui est generee.

Sub TableauV6()
Dim Etagere() As Integer
Dim NombreCase As Integer
NombreCase = Val(InputBox("Combien d'éléments voulez-vous ?" ))
ReDim Etagere(NombreCase)
For compteur = 1 To NombreCase
Etagere(compteur) = InputBox("Entrez le nombre N°" & compteur & " : " )
Next
For compteur = 1 To NombreCase
Selection.TypeText Etagere(compteur)
Selection.TypeParagraph
Next
End Sub

L'erreur apparait apres avoir saisi le nombre d'elements et les elements dans chaque case, par exemple:
2 elements, 100 dans le numero 1 et 200 dans le numero 2.

Paeil pour celle-ci:
Sub TableauV7()
Dim Etagere() As Integer
Dim NombreCase As Integer
NombreCase = Val(InputBox("Combien d'éléments voulez-vous ?" ))
ReDim Etagere(NombreCase)
For compteur = 1 To NombreCase
Etagere(compteur) = InputBox("Entrez le nombre N°" & compteur & " : " )
Next
For compteur = 1 To NombreCase
Selection.TypeText Etagere(compteur)
Selection.TypeParagraph
Next
Dim LePlusGrand As Integer
LePlusGrand = 0
For compteur = 1 To NombreCase
If Etagere(compteur) > LePlusGrand Then
LePlusGrand = Etagere(compteur)
End If
Next
Selection.TypeText "Le plus grand est " & LePlusGrand
End Sub

Je crois que l'erreur vient de Selection.TypeText mais je comprends pas pourquoi.
Qqn peut m'aider?
A voir également:

1 réponse

jan_clode Messages postés 2 Statut Membre
 
Merci pour votre aide.
0